Yeah, so that's what we're seeing a lot of our customers use Prism for right now.
And it was in our product roadmap to make it easier to move concerts around the platform.
We went ahead and advanced those features to kind of be responsive to the crisis and do things for our customers that really matter.
Another thing that we're moving forward is our financial reporting tools.
A lot of them like deeply need to understand like how much money is coming in.
Like what, what is my, what is my operating expenses over the next few months and prison helps with that.
So we're advancing and optimizing those.
